The Economic Landscape of Bristol

Bristol, a vibrant city in the southwest of England, has been making significant strides in its economic landscape. Known for its rich history, cultural diversity, and technological innovation, Bristol is increasingly becoming a hub for financial activities. This article delves into the various factors contributing to Bristol’s economic resurgence, highlighting key sectors and recent developments that are shaping the city’s financial future.

Technological Innovation and Startups

The city’s thriving startup scene is a cornerstone of its economic growth. Bristol’s tech sector has seen a surge in investment, with numerous startups emerging in fields such as fintech, biotech, and renewable energy. The city’s universities, particularly the University of Bristol and the University of the West of England, play a crucial role in fostering innovation and entrepreneurship. These institutions not only provide a skilled workforce but also serve as incubators for new ideas and technologies.

Moreover, Bristol’s commitment to sustainability and green energy has attracted significant attention. The city is home to several renewable energy projects, including wind and solar energy initiatives. This focus on sustainability aligns with global trends and positions Bristol as a leader in the green economy.

Cultural and Creative Industries

Bristol’s cultural and creative industries are also playing a pivotal role in its economic growth. The city is renowned for its vibrant arts scene, which includes music, film, and visual arts. This cultural richness attracts tourists and investors alike, contributing to the city’s economic prosperity.

The creative industries in Bristol are supported by a network of galleries, museums, and cultural events. These institutions not only provide entertainment but also create jobs and stimulate economic activity. The city’s creative sector is also known for its innovation, with many startups and established companies working on cutting-edge projects.

Challenges and Future Prospects

Despite its economic resurgence, Bristol faces several challenges. Housing affordability, traffic congestion, and environmental sustainability are among the key issues that need to be addressed. The city’s rapid growth has put pressure on its infrastructure and resources, requiring strategic planning and investment to ensure sustainable development.

Looking ahead, Bristol’s future prospects appear bright. The city’s commitment to innovation, sustainability, and economic diversification positions it well for continued growth. By addressing its challenges and leveraging its strengths, Bristol can solidify its place as a leading economic hub in the UK.
